**Checklist: Flip on the Skybird fare-pricing experiment**

Before you enable the Skybird pricing experiment, double-check the cohort split is still 10/90 and the rollback flag works — we've been burned before. Ping the analytics folks so their dashboards don't look haunted. Once you've sanity-checked a canary purchase, jot the build token you shipped right below.

pipeline stamp: htk4_ae36

Q: Does the Quillbase admin dashboard support dark mode?
A: Yes, since release 4.2. Toggle it under Settings > Appearance, or set it per-user via the preferences API. It follows the OS theme by default. Known gaps: the legacy billing tab and some embedded charts still render light-only; fixes are tracked by the Fernwick UI squad. Don't file new tickets for contrast issues on the reports page — already known. Theming tokens, screenshots, and the rollout status for remaining pages live on this internal page.

wiki page, tahaf-tajog: https://jira.ordindyn.corp/pipeline

Handover — Ferndale Franchise Agreement

Hi all — quick note as I hand this to Director Paval Rin. The Ferndale franchise deal with Moxa Grill Co. is 90% drafted; royalty terms and territory map still open. Legal wants one more pass. Department heads, please hold related announcements. Paval, the sensitive background you'll need is right below.

confidential, kagup-bafog: Fraaxax Group is in early talks to buy Soroxox Group for about $343.8 million. The Olidor launch date is June 14, and nothing goes to the press before then. Legal wants the Aldmirek Logistics term sheet signed before July 23.